Key Facts
- New York state income tax on $33,015,000 is $3,351,898 — 10.15% of gross income.
- Combined with federal taxes and FICA, total tax burden is $16,303,889 (49.38%).
- Take-home pay is $16,711,111, or $1,392,593 per month.
- NYC residents pay additional 3.078%–3.876%; Yonkers adds 1.477%
